Pick up from accommodation in Trujillo around 2pm. Then we will start our visit of the famous Huaca Arco Iris (Huaca Dragón) and the Huaca Esmeralda.
Afterwards, we get an insight to the site of Chan Chan in the official museum and also visit the Nickán Palace, the palace enclosure we enter a labyrinthine series of courtyards lined with clay friezes of fish and ocean birds, and walled in places with an open meshwork adobe building style believed to represent fishing nets. We visit inner patios, residences, administrative buildings, temples, platforms and storehouses, and a huge reservoir where "sunken gardens" may have produced specialized crops for the Chimu nobility.
